Tatsoi is a compact Asian green forming beautiful rosettes of dark, spoon-shaped leaves with a mild mustard flavor. It is extremely cold-hardy and versatile.

Union Parish, Louisiana is in USDA Zone 8b. The average last spring frost is March 22 and the first fall frost is November 5, giving you a growing season of approximately 228 days.

At an elevation of 426 feet, Union Parish receives approximately 57.4 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ly loam soil. Summer highs average 96°F, so Tatsoi may need afternoon shade and extra watering during peak heat. Ample rainfall means less supplemental watering, but ensure good drainage to prevent Tatsoi root diseases.

Percentages indicate frost risk at transplant. The 70% safe window means there is a 30% chance of frost after transplant — suitable for cold-hardy crops or gardeners with frost protection. The 90% safe window is best for tender plants.

What are Growing Degree Days (GDD)?

Growing Degree Days measure the total warmth your plants receive during the growing season. Think of it as a "heat bank" — every day above 50°F deposits warmth that helps your plants grow.

Each plant needs a certain amount of accumulated heat to mature. If your county provides more GDD than the plant needs, it's a great fit. If it's close, you may want to choose faster-maturing varieties or start seeds indoors to get a head start.

Tatsoi needs ~935 GDD — county provides 5,016 GDD Excellent fit

Growing Tips for Tatsoi in Union Parish

Direct sow Tatsoi outdoors after March 22 in Union Parish when soil has warmed and frost danger has passed.

With summer highs reaching 96°F in Union Parish, provide afternoon shade for Tatsoi and water deeply in the morning.

Your generous 228.0-day season in Union Parish allows multiple plantings of Tatsoi. Sow every 17.0 days for continuous harvest.

Common pests for Tatsoi in this region include cabbage worm and flea beetles. Use row covers early in the season and inspect plants weekly.

General growing tips

Direct sow in spring or fall. Tatsoi tolerates frost down to 15F. Harvest outer leaves or cut whole rosettes. Excellent in salads, stir-fries, or lightly wilted.
